Performance Optimization im Webdesign ist von großer Bedeutung, um Webseiten schnell, reaktionsschnell und benutzerfreundlich zu machen. In diesem Artikel werden wir erklären, was Performance Optimization bedeutet, warum sie wichtig ist und verschiedene Ansätze, Techniken und bewährte Methoden diskutieren, um die Leistung von Webseiten zu verbessern. Wir werden auch die Auswirkungen einer optimierten Performance auf Benutzererfahrung, Conversion-Raten und Suchmaschinen-Rankings erläutern und praktische Tipps zur Implementierung geben.
Performance Optimization im Webdesign
Performance Optimization bezieht sich auf die Bemühungen, die Geschwindigkeit, Reaktionsfähigkeit und Effizienz einer Webseite zu maximieren. Es geht darum, die Ladezeit zu minimieren und sicherzustellen, dass eine Webseite schnell und nahtlos aufgerufen werden kann. Durch eine optimierte Performance wird nicht nur die Benutzererfahrung verbessert, sondern auch die Conversion-Raten erhöht und die Sichtbarkeit in Suchmaschinen verbessert.
Warum ist Performance Optimization wichtig?
Eine optimierte Performance ist entscheidend, da Benutzer heutzutage schnelle Ladezeiten und reaktionsschnelle Webseiten erwarten. Langsame Ladezeiten können Besucher frustrieren und dazu führen, dass sie die Webseite verlassen, was zu einem Verlust von potenziellen Kunden oder Lesern führt. Darüber hinaus berücksichtigen Suchmaschinen wie Google die Ladezeit als Ranking-Faktor, sodass eine schlechte Performance einer Webseite ihre Sichtbarkeit und Auffindbarkeit beeinträchtigen kann.
Ansätze zur Performance Optimization
Es gibt verschiedene effektive Ansätze und bewährte Techniken, die dazu beitragen können, die Leistung von Webseiten signifikant zu verbessern. Im Folgenden finden Sie einige wichtige Aspekte, die bei der Performance Optimization berücksichtigt werden sollten.
Caching
Durch das Caching von Ressourcen wie CSS- und JavaScript-Dateien können wiederholte Seitenaufrufe beschleunigt werden. Beim Caching werden bereits heruntergeladene Ressourcen im Browser zwischengespeichert, was zu schnelleren Seitenladezeiten führt. Dadurch müssen die Ressourcen nicht jedes Mal erneut vom Server geladen werden.
Bildoptimierung
Bilder sind oft größere Dateien, die die Ladezeit einer Webseite beeinflussen können. Eine effektive Bildoptimierung, wie beispielsweise die Komprimierung der Bilder und die Verwendung des richtigen Dateiformats, kann die Dateigröße erheblich reduzieren und somit die Ladezeit verbessern. Dabei sollte jedoch darauf geachtet werden, die Bildqualität nicht übermäßig zu beeinträchtigen.
Code-Minifizierung
Durch die Entfernung von unnötigen Leerzeichen, Zeilenumbrüchen und Kommentaren im HTML-, CSS- und JavaScript-Code kann die Dateigröße reduziert und die Ladezeit verkürzt werden. Dies wird als Code-Minifizierung bezeichnet und führt zu einer optimierten Übertragung der Dateien vom Server zum Browser.
Ressourcenkonsolidierung
Durch das Zusammenführen mehrerer Ressourcen wie CSS- und JavaScript-Dateien zu einer einzigen Datei kann die Anzahl der Serveranfragen reduziert und die Ladezeit optimiert werden. Dies geschieht, indem der Code effizient organisiert wird, um die Anzahl der zu übertragenden Dateien zu minimieren. Dadurch wird die Gesamtgröße der Anfragen reduziert und die Webseite lädt schneller.
Diese Ansätze zur Performance Optimization helfen dabei, die Ladezeiten zu minimieren und die Gesamtperformance einer Webseite zu verbessern. Indem sie die Anzahl der Serveranfragen reduzieren, die Dateigrößen optimieren und die Datenübertragung effizienter gestalten, können Websitebetreiber und Designer sicherstellen, dass ihre Webseiten schnell, reaktionsschnell und benutzerfreundlich sind. Durch die Implementierung dieser bewährten Techniken wird eine optimale Webseitenleistung erreicht, was sich positiv auf die Benutzererfahrung, die Conversion-Raten und das Suchmaschinen-Ranking auswirkt.
Auswirkungen einer optimierten Performance
Eine optimierte Performance mit schnellen Ladezeiten und reibungsloser Navigation trägt maßgeblich zu einer herausragenden Benutzererfahrung bei. Besucher verweilen länger auf der Webseite, interagieren intensiver mit dem Inhalt und sind eher geneigt, immer wieder zurückzukehren und die Seite weiterzuempfehlen.
Eine verbesserte Performance kann signifikant zu höheren Conversion-Raten führen. Benutzer sind eher bereit, gewünschte Aktionen wie Käufe, Anmeldungen oder das Ausfüllen von Formularen durchzuführen, wenn sie eine Webseite vorfinden, die schnell, zuverlässig und benutzerfreundlich ist. Eine nahtlose Nutzererfahrung trägt dazu bei, Vertrauen aufzubauen und Besucher zu motivieren, den gewünschten Handlungsschritten zu folgen.
Suchmaschinen, allen voran Google, betrachten die Ladezeit als einen entscheidenden Faktor bei der Bewertung von Webseiten. Eine schnellere Webseite hat eine höhere Wahrscheinlichkeit, in den Suchergebnissen besser platziert zu werden. Eine verbesserte Performance führt zu einer höheren Sichtbarkeit, was wiederum zu mehr organischen Traffic und potenziell mehr Conversions führt.
Diese Auswirkungen einer optimierten Performance unterstreichen die Bedeutung einer schnellen und reaktionsschnellen Webseite. Durch die Schaffung einer nahtlosen und ansprechenden Benutzererfahrung steigt die Nutzerzufriedenheit, die Wahrscheinlichkeit von Conversions erhöht sich und die Suchmaschinen-Rankings verbessern sich. Es ist daher unerlässlich, die Performance einer Webseite zu optimieren, um die Vorteile in Bezug auf Benutzerbindung, Geschäftserfolg und Online-Sichtbarkeit optimal auszuschöpfen.
Best Practices für Performance Optimization
Um eine optimale Performance für Webseiten zu erreichen, ist es wichtig, bewährte Best Practices zu beachten.
Verwenden Sie Tools wie Google PageSpeed Insights oder Webpagetest.org, um die aktuelle Performance einer Webseite zu analysieren und Schwachstellen zu identifizieren. Diese Tools liefern detaillierte Einblicke in die Ladezeiten, Ressourcenoptimierung und andere Aspekte, die für die Performance relevant sind.
Laden Sie zuerst kritische Inhalte wie Texte und Funktionalitäten und laden Sie sekundäre Inhalte wie Bilder und Videos nach. Dies ermöglicht eine schnellere Erstladung der wichtigen Inhalte und verbessert die Benutzererfahrung. Eine sogenannte „Lazy Loading“-Technik kann eingesetzt werden, um nicht sofort sichtbare Inhalte verzögert nachzuladen.
Verwenden Sie Komprimierungstechniken für Dateien wie CSS und JavaScript, um die Dateigröße zu reduzieren. Durch die Komprimierung werden Dateien effizienter übertragen und die Ladezeiten verkürzt. Darüber hinaus sollten Sie den Code minifizieren, um überflüssige Zeichen wie Leerzeichen, Zeilenumbrüche und Kommentare zu entfernen. Dies verringert die Dateigröße weiter und beschleunigt die Übertragung.
Nutzen Sie Content Delivery Networks (CDNs), um statische Ressourcen wie Bilder, CSS- und JavaScript-Dateien über verschiedene Serverstandorte zu verteilen. Durch die Integration eines CDNs wird die Ladezeit reduziert, da die Ressourcen von einem Server in der Nähe des Benutzers bereitgestellt werden. Dies ermöglicht eine schnellere Übertragung und verbessert die Performance insbesondere für Besucher aus verschiedenen Regionen.
Wenn Ihre Webseite auf eine Datenbank zugreift, ist es wichtig, effiziente Datenbankabfragen zu verwenden. Verwenden Sie Indexierungen, um die Abfrageleistung zu verbessern, und optimieren Sie komplexe Abfragen, um die Antwortzeit zu verkürzen.
Zusammenfassung
Performance Optimization im Webdesign ist entscheidend, um Webseiten schnell, reaktionsschnell und benutzerfreundlich zu machen. Durch die Implementierung verschiedener Ansätze und Techniken wie Caching, Bildoptimierung und Code-Minifizierung können Websitebetreiber und Designer die Ladezeiten minimieren und die Leistung ihrer Webseiten optimieren. Eine optimierte Performance führt zu einer besseren Benutzererfahrung, höheren Conversion-Raten und verbesserten Suchmaschinen-Rankings. Durch die Einhaltung bewährter Best Practices können sie sicherstellen, dass ihre Webseiten das Potenzial voll ausschöpfen und die Erwartungen der Besucher erfüllen.